Wolfgang Mueller is a scholar working on Astronomy and Astrophysics, Immunology and Cancer Research. According to data from OpenAlex, Wolfgang Mueller has authored 30 papers receiving a total of 413 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 5 papers in Astronomy and Astrophysics, 4 papers in Immunology and 4 papers in Cancer Research. Recurrent topics in Wolfgang Mueller's work include Planetary Science and Exploration (4 papers), Immunotoxicology and immune responses (3 papers) and Carcinogens and Genotoxicity Assessment (3 papers). Wolfgang Mueller is often cited by papers focused on Planetary Science and Exploration (4 papers), Immunotoxicology and immune responses (3 papers) and Carcinogens and Genotoxicity Assessment (3 papers). Wolfgang Mueller collaborates with scholars based in United States, Germany and Spain. Wolfgang Mueller's co-authors include Leland D. Loose, F. Coulston, K.‐F. Benitz, Kelly Pittman, Jay B. Silkworth, F. Körte, Karl K. Rozman, Jörg Arndt, Wolf von Engelhardt and W. Hobson and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Agricultural and Food Chemistry, Chemosphere and Infection and Immunity.
